摘要

1. A gasification based, small-scale waste-to-energy plant, having a nominal throughput of 5000 t/y of a Secondary Recovered Fuel obtained from unsorted residual waste, has been investigated. 2. The technical performances of a heat gasifier configuration of this plant have been quantitatively assessed. Mass and energy balances of the proposed plant were based on the experimental data obtained from a pilot scale bubbling fluidized bed air gasifier. 3. An innovative mild combustion system has been pro posed to burn the syngas and has been coupled with an Organic Rankine Cycle generator. 4. The results, together with those of a preliminary economic analysis, indicate that the proposed plant configuration, including a bubbling fluidized bed reactor, a mild combustion system, a 400kWe ORC generator and a simple air pollution control system, appears fully sustainable.
